java客户端配置如何设计

java客户端配置如何设计

作者:William Gu发布时间:2026-02-27 10:58阅读时长:15 分钟阅读次数:9
常见问答
Q
如何有效管理Java客户端的配置文件?

在开发Java客户端应用时,怎样管理配置文件才能确保配置的灵活性和安全性?

A

Java客户端配置文件管理策略

管理Java客户端的配置文件可以采用分环境配置、加密敏感信息、使用统一的配置格式(如YAML或Properties)等方法,确保配置内容在不同环境下灵活切换且安全可靠。此外,可以通过配置中心或配置管理工具实现集中管理及动态更新。

Q
怎样设计Java客户端的配置加载机制?

Java客户端程序在启动或运行时,如何设计配置加载机制以保证配置的实时性和稳定性?

A

高效的配置加载设计

设计配置加载机制时,可以使用懒加载或热加载的方式,使配置在客户端运行时能够动态刷新而不重启应用。同时,结合缓存策略和容错机制提高读取效率和可靠性,避免因配置信息异常导致客户端崩溃。

Q
如何提升Java客户端配置设计的可维护性?

在Java客户端配置设计过程中,有哪些方法能增加配置的可维护性和扩展性?

A

增强配置可维护性的设计方法

采用模块化配置结构,保持配置项的清晰分类,减少耦合度,有助于维护和扩展。此外,使用注解绑定配置和类型安全的配置读取库,可以降低代码错误率,提升配置管理的整体质量。